My wifes cousin's daughters, ages 14 and 17, just received their Visitors Visas to Canada to come for the summer for ESL School. The process was easy, acceptance letter from the school, proof that they had paid for the schooling, inivitation letter from us saying that we would be responsible for their expenses while in Canada, and permission letter from their parents.
